ا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

الردود الموصى بها

قام بنشر

السلام عليكم

اريد من الاخوة المساعدة في حل المشكلة وهي تحويل القيمتين العشرية الى أصفار

مثال اذا كانت القيمة التي عندي هي 10.16 اريدها ان تصبح   10.00

15.09   اريدها ان تصبح     15.00

19.99  اريدها ان تصبح       19.00

اي ليس التقريب بل ازالة كلية للقيمة العشرية وتحويلها الى أصفار

وبارك الله فيكم

قام بنشر

كليك يمين على عمود الأرقام بعد تظليلة بالكامل

ثم "FORMAT CELLS " ثم  "NUMBER" ثم "CUSTEM " ثم "TYPE "

ثم فى المستطيل أسفلها أكتب الأتى:

##."00"

بالطبع هناك معادلات لعمل ذلك ولكن هذه أفضل وأسهل

تقبل تحياتى

قام بنشر

بارك الله فيك اخي لكن المشكلة مازالت قائمة فهو يكتب لي القيم بالاصفار ولكن في الحساب يقوم به غلى القيم العشرية كان لم يكن شيء

انا اريد القيمة تصبح فيها الجزء العشري يكتب صفر ويساوي فعلا صفر حتى في الحساب

وشكرا

قام بنشر

اشكرك اخي على المساعدة لكن اريد ان اطبق على نفس الخلية وليس خلية اخرى

لذلك لا تصلح الدالة INT لانني ساطبق على نفس الخلية التي اقف عليها

هل من طريقة اخرى وشكرا

قام بنشر

واضح جدا إننى سأستدرج فى كتابة الكود وأن كنت أرفض ذلك ، وعاهدت نفسى على ذلك

ولكن نظرا لغياب عمالقة الأكواد فأنا مضطر

أليك أخى الكود التالى سيحقق ماتريد

أو أستخدم هذا وهذا أعم ويشمل تنسيق الرقم أيضا

يكفى تظليل مدى الأرقام الذى تريد تحويلها

Sub GAMAL()
    Dim rng As Range
    Dim cell As Range
    Set rng = Selection
    For Each cell In rng
        cell = Int(cell)
        cell.NumberFormat = "0.00"
    Next
End Sub

وهذا أيضا حتى يكون الكود الأخير ولن أكررها

Sub gamal()
  Dim adr As String
  
  adr = "A1:A" & Range("A" & Rows.Count).End(xlUp).Row '<- Change column & start row to suit
  With Range(adr)
    .Value = Evaluate("IF(LEN(" & adr & "),TRUNC(" & adr & "),"""")")
    .NumberFormat = "0.00"
  End With
End Sub

تقبل تحياتى

أستخراج الرقم قبل العلامة 2 العشرية.rar

أستخراج الرقم قبل العلامة العشرية.rar

انشئ حساب جديد او قم بتسجيل دخولك لتتمكن من اضافه تعليق جديد

يجب ان تكون عضوا لدينا لتتمكن من التعليق

انشئ حساب جديد

سجل حسابك الجديد لدينا في الموقع بمنتهي السهوله .

سجل حساب جديد

تسجيل دخول

هل تمتلك حساب بالفعل ؟ سجل دخولك من هنا.

سجل دخولك الان
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information